How to get there

Bus
Bus
Recommended
Transperth bus route 935 and the free Blue CAT bus provide direct access to the park, with stops at Fraser Avenue and Wadjuk Way, respectively.
Walking
Walking
Recommended
Pedestrian access from the city is available via Jacob's Ladder or Fraser Avenue, with walking trails throughout the park.
Bike
Bike
Cycling is permitted on main roads and designated shared paths. Bike racks are available at key locations, and bike hire is available near the Visitor Information Centre.
Car
Car
Visitors can drive to the park via Kings Park Road and park for free in designated car parks, including Wadjuk Carpark.
Shuttle
Shuttle
During evening events, a free express shuttle bus service operates from Elizabeth Quay Bus Station (Stop E5) to Kings Park every 15 minutes, starting from 6 pm.
Taxi
Taxi
Taxis and rideshare services can drop off and pick up passengers at the designated cab spot behind Fraser's Restaurant on Fraser Avenue.
